Watched Scholes at Elland road in 91 or 92 when he was with the Man Utd youth team in the cup final against us. He was well up for it, gestures at the crowd, putting himself around the pitch some reet tackles if i remember rightly. He was head and shoulders the best player on the pitch which was saying something as both teams produced some excellent players.
